toqito.matrix_props.is_positive_definite¶
Checks if the matrix is a positive definite matrix.
Module Contents¶
- toqito.matrix_props.is_positive_definite.is_positive_definite(mat)[source]¶
Check if matrix is positive definite (PD) [@WikiPosDef].
Examples
Consider the following matrix
- [
- A = begin{pmatrix}
2 & -1 & 0 \ -1 & 2 & -1 \ 0 & -1 & 2
end{pmatrix}
]
our function indicates that this is indeed a positive definite matrix.
```python exec=”1” source=”above” import numpy as np from toqito.matrix_props import is_positive_definite
A = np.array([[2, -1, 0], [-1, 2, -1], [0, -1, 2]])
print(is_positive_definite(A)) ```
Alternatively, the following example matrix (B) defined as
- [
- B = begin{pmatrix}
-1 & -1 \ -1 & -1
end{pmatrix}
]
is not positive definite.
```python exec=”1” source=”above” import numpy as np from toqito.matrix_props import is_positive_definite
B = np.array([[-1, -1], [-1, -1]])
print(is_positive_definite(B)) ```

- Parameters:
mat (numpy.ndarray) – Matrix to check.
- Returns:
Return True if matrix is positive definite, and False otherwise.
- Return type:
bool
